Motilal Oswal Financial Services Files SEBI Certificate for Q3 FY26
Motilal Oswal Financial Services Limited submitted a SEBI certificate for the quarter ended December 31, 2025. The certificate was received from the Registrar and Share Transfer Agent, MUFG Intime India Private Limited, confirming the processing of dematerialised securities.
This is a standard regulatory filing and does not involve any material changes or events that would significantly impact the company's operations or stock performance.
The announcement is a routine compliance filing regarding share transfer and dematerialisation, with no significant financial or operational impact on the company.
Motilal Oswal Financial Services Limited (MOTILALOFS) has submitted a certificate under Regulation 74(5) of the SEBI (Depositories and Participants) Regulations, 2018. This certificate pertains to the quarter ended December 31, 2025.
The company received this confirmation from its Registrar and Share Transfer Agent, MUFG Intime India Private Limited (formerly Link Intime India Private Limited). The certificate confirms that securities received from depository participants for dematerialisation during the specified quarter were processed and confirmed with the depositories.
MUFG Intime India Private Limited also confirmed that the security certificates received for dematerialisation were either accepted or rejected after verification by the depository participant. Following this, the names of the depositories were substituted in the register of members as the registered owners within the prescribed timelines.
